INSIGHT

Horizontal Point Tools Are Most Vulnerable

  • 'Exposed' SaaS are horizontal point solutions with weak moats, easy to replicate by prompting LLMs and vibe-coding.
  • Ross warns these products face margin compression when a $400/month tool can be spun up via Claude or GPT in minutes.
INSIGHT

Systems Of Record Face Interface Disruption

  • 'Embedded' platforms are systems of record deeply integrated in enterprises and expensive to replace, so they won't vanish overnight.
  • However Ross expects agent interfaces to change workflows as agents talk to APIs and layer over or abstract current UIs.
